For the first time in about a year, I got skunked yesterday. Cherokee Lake usually isn't too kind to me, but she was exceptionally tough yesterday. One of those days where days where I ran everything, and threw the whole tackle box at them, and just couldn't get anything going. Backs of creeks, secondary stuff, docks, main lake bluffs, transitions, points, and some long flats, it just didn't matter.

 

From 12:30 until dark I only managed one for sure bite which came late in the evening when I tossed a jig into a big laydown on a bluff. That fish had me wrapped around a limb and broke off almost immediately. That ended another streak for me, because it has also been about a year since I've broke off a fish.

 

I'm not complaining, I love to get out on the water regardless, and I don't get too upset when things don't go well. I just find it interesting how tough fishing can be at times, and how you can always get humbled on a fishing trip.
